Welcome

Through the DCU Career Mentoring programme our graduates give back to Dublin City University volunteering time, experience and expertise to mentor a second-year student at a crucial stage of their studies.

The DCU Career Mentoring programme, formerly known as the DCU Structured Mentorship Programme, won the prestigious IITD National Training Award for Excellence in Coaching and Mentoring for 2018 and was shortlisted as a finalist in 2020 and 2021. It is a joint initiative, co-organised by the Alumni Office and the Careers Service. 

The programme runs for six-months between November and April and pairs second-year students with alumni mentors for the purpose of career and professional development.

Alumni and students are matched based on their areas of professional expertise, DCU course and areas of interest. Alumni mentors are asked, if possible, to provide their student mentee with a work-shadowing day as part of the programme.

The programme remains a key initiative for the Alumni Office and continues to grow each year; 193 Mentor and Mentees were matched in 2024, a 6% increase on matched mentors and mentees in 2023.

2025/2026 Career Mentoring Programme Schedule

June/July/August

  • June - Applications Open
  • July/August - Mentor information sessions

September/October

  • September 1 - Applications close
  • Late September - Matching Process: Mentor/ Mentee matching selection via the portal and manual matching where necessary
  • Early to mid October - First Mentor/ Mentee introductory email sent by the Alumni Office
  • Late Oct - Remaining Mentor/ Mentee introductory email sent by the Alumni Office
  • Mentor/Mentee meetings to take place once intro email has been sent

November

  • Mentor Networking event on Glasnevin Campus
  • Career Mentoring Opening event
  • First Mentor Monthly Meet-up

 

December/ January/ February

  • December - Mentor Monthly Meetup
  • January - Mentor event
  • January - Mentor Monthly Meetup
  • February - Work Shadow Day
  • February - Mentor Monthly Meetup

March/April

  • Nominations Open for Mentor and Mentee of the Year Awards
  • Mentor pre-ceremony event on Glasnevin Campus
  • DCU Career Mentoring Closing Ceremony
  • Mentor and Mentee of the Year Presentations
